摘要
Using a two-step procedure based on (i) anchoring an organogold precursor within the channels of functionalized ordered mesoporous silica containing mercapto groups; (ii) followed by chemical reduction, we prepared materials containing gold (0) nanoparticles exclusively located within the pore channels. By modifying the organogold precursor/mercapto groups ratio, we demonstrate the necessity of the complexation of the organogold precursor prior to reduction. Using this methodology, gold content as high as 16.1 wt % with a narrow size distribution of nanoparticles regularly distributed within the pores of the material was achieved.
